About the School
The British School of Barcelona (BSB) is a British monitored independent school located in Sitges, Spain. It is an HMC school judged by a recent BSO inspection to be outstanding in every area, including quality of education, safeguarding, pupil welfare and academic outcomes.
BSB is a large, very popular school for children aged 3 to 18. Our curriculum is based on the English National Curriculum, and we offer a wide range of GCSEs, A levels and the International Baccalaureate Diploma, alongside a significant enrichment programme.
More than 2000 pupils from over 74 nationalities attend the school and over 315 staff work at BSB. We operate in three locations, two just outside the city of Barcelona – in Castelldefels (Primary, Secondary and Pre‑University campus) and in the cosmopolitan town of Sitges (Primary campus). BSB City is in the heart of the city of Barcelona itself, with a Foundation campus (built September 2021) and a brand‑new main campus that opened in September 2023.
The growth of the school has been accompanied by significant investment, including the building of a state‑of‑the‑art Pre‑University Centre (Nexus), a full‑sized 4G rugby and football pitch, dedicated STEM facilities and the new BSB City campuses. About Cognita
Cognita is a global leader in independent education. Founded in 2004, it is a growing community of more than 100 schools in 21 countries – in Europe, North America, Latin America, Asia and the Middle East – serving over 100,000 students.
